Remove MEncoder
Disable MEncoder compilation and remove files used by MEncoder only. There's no attempt to remove all references to MEncoder from the build system, documentation etc at this point. Removed files: (muxers, audio/video encoders, misc) mencoder.c cfg-mencoder.h parser-mecmd.[ch] xvid_vbr.[ch] libmpdemux/muxer* libmpcodecs/ae* libmpcodecs/ve* libmpcodecs/native/rtjpegn.[ch] libmpcodecs/native/mmx.h // was used by rtjpegn only Rationale: MEncoder is still useful for some people, but there's not much potential for further development; in the long run almost all use cases can be handled better by solutions based on something else (for example using FFmpeg or encoding MPlayer output). FFmpeg is already getting video filtering support which should work for some common MEncoder uses. Keeping MEncoder working takes extra work that is away from player development. While that amount of work is not huge (mostly MEncoder can be just ignored), it's not completely insignificant either. MEncoder is still maintained to some degree in the svn tree, so if necessary it's possible to use it from there for now. This tree has never had major improvements for the MEncoder side, so using svn MEncoder instead should be no major loss.
